Average marks scored by Vineet in five subjects are 60.
The average marks scored by him (excluding his highest and lowest marks) are 50 and lowest marks scored by him are 40. Find the highest marks scored by him.Solution
Sum of marks scored by him in five subjects = 5 x 60 = 300 Sum of marks scored by him (excluding his highest and lowest marks) = 3 x 50 = 150 Therefore, sum of highest and lowest marks = 300 – 150 = 150 So, highest marks scored by him = 150 – 40 = 110
